Roots fans in the aquaculture process monitoring and maintenance methods

In the aquaculture process, Roots fans play a key role for providing oxygen supply, stirring and mixing, gas circulation and other functions. The following are the monitoring and maintenance methods for Roots fans in the aquaculture process: Monitoring methods: Operating parameter monitoring: monitor the operating parameters of the Roots fan, including current, voltage, frequency, and temperature. Through real-time monitoring of operating parameters, abnormalities can be detected in time and appropriate measures can be taken. Pressure monitoring: monitor the outlet pressure and inlet pressure of the Roots fan. Under normal circumstances, the difference between the two should be within the design range, if the difference is too large or too small, it may indicate that there are problems with the Roots fan. How to Maintain Your Roots Blower for Optimal Performance

REGULAR CLEANING: Regular cleaning of your Roots fan is an important step in maintaining its performance. Removing dust, dirt and other impurities from the fan prevents clogging and increases the efficiency of the fan's operation. Use a soft brush or compressed air to clean the external surfaces of the fan and disassemble and clean the internal parts periodically. Lubrication: Roots fans typically require proper lubrication to ensure smooth operation. Regularly check and change the fan's lubricating oil or grease according to the manufacturer's recommendations. Ensure that the lubricant is at the correct level and quality, monitor the working condition of the lubrication system during operation, and replenish and replace it promptly.
